l???? Conductors: Circular tinned annealed stranded copper wire to IEC 60228 class 2.
l???? Insulation: Halogen free EPR compound.
l???? Twinning: Colour coded cores twisted together.
l???? Filler: Water blocking fillers, if required.
l???? Individual Shielding: Each pairs/triples are screened by copper backed polyester tape in contact with a stranded tinned copper drain wire and wrapped with polyester tape. Pairs/triples are numbered with numbered tape or by numbers printed directly on the insulated conductors.
l???? Filler: Water blocking fillers, if required.
l???? Bedding: Halogen free compound, PETP wrapping tape will be applied over the bedding, if required.
l???? Armour: Tinned copper wire braid, PETP wrapping tape will be applied over the braiding, if required.
l???? Water Blocking Elements: Water blocking tape and strings for providing longitudinal water tightness.
l???? Inner Sheath: Halogen free thermosetting compound, SHF2 (for TYPE S1). Halogen free MUD resistant thermosetting compound, SHF MUD (for TYPE S1/S5), coloured grey (blue for intrinsically safe).
l???? Outer Sheath: Polyurethane for providing transversal water tightness, PE is optional,but can not meet low smoke standard.
